Delirious? To Perform At The Olympic Games In Athens This Summer Delirious? will be joining the thousands of other 'History Makers' in Athens this August for the 2004 Summer Olympic Games. The band have been asked to headline a concert at Omonia Square in Athens city center as part of the Opening Night Olympic Celebrations organised by the the Cultural Committee of Athens.

The band have agreed to interrupt their planned summer break and will be performing in Athens on 14th August. The Olympic Games are the World's most prestigious sporting event, watched by a global TV audience in excess of three billion. The Cultural Programme for Athens 2004 begun in March with events designed for the Greek Torch Relay, and concludes in September, with events for the Paralympic Games.

According to the Greek Department of Culture, the Culture Programme "Demonstrates the cultural aspect of the Olympic Games. Accessible to all audiences, the official Cultural Programme of the Games aims to transfer the Olympic Experience beyond the Competition venues. It is a flexible, tailor-made programme that addresses all segments of Olympic constituents and includes performances by Greek and international artists representing all art forms."
